what does the verbal irony in this text suggest? according to mr. hollands kids, his snoring is as quiet as a jackhammer. the snoring occurs in bursts. the snoring is loud. the snoring is subtle.

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Verbal irony involves saying the opposite of what is meant. A jackhammer is very loud, so describing snoring as "as quiet as a jackhammer" is ironic and actually suggests the snoring is loud. The option about bursts isn't supported, and "subtle" contradicts the irony (since a jackhammer is not subtle or quiet).

Answer:

The snoring is loud.
